The Christina Noble Children's Foundation is dedicated to serving vulnerable children in Vietnam & Mongolia who are in need of emergency and long-term medical care, nutritional rehabilitation, educational opportunities, job placement and protecting those at risk of economic and sexual exploitation.

The Mongol Rally involves driving a car no bigger than a matchbox, with an engine yielding less pulling power than a lame donkey, 10,000 miles from London to Mongolia.

You may ask why we are doing this!? First and foremost it's for the kids - in particular the underprivileged children of Mongolia as cared for by the Christina Noble Children's Foundation. This worthy cause is committed to protecting the lives of vulnerable children throughout Vietnam and Mongolia and seeks to give these children hope through new opportunities in education and vocational qualifications.
